已编辑 2 几个月前 通过 ExtremeHow 编辑团队
NetBeans集成开发环境性能问题故障排除软件集成开发环境开发编程优化增强
翻译更新 2 几个月前
NetBeans是许多开发人员使用的热门集成开发环境(IDE),用于创建各种编程语言的应用程序。然而,与任何软件一样,NetBeans也可能面临性能问题,从而减慢您的工作速度。让我们来看一下各种策略和技巧,以有效解决这些性能问题。
在我们进入解决方案之前,了解使用NetBeans时可能面临的性能问题非常重要。常见的性能问题包括加载时间过长、用户界面迟缓、打字时滞后、编译时滞后、高内存使用率和意外崩溃。识别这些问题是找到有效解决方案的第一步。
通常,性能问题可能不仅与NetBeans有关,还与系统设置有关。以下是一些确保您的系统最佳运行的常规提示:
接下来,探索NetBeans中的设置。调整配置设置可以显著提高性能:
etc/netbeans.conf
文件来调整此设置。查找以下行:
-J-Xmx1024m
对于有更多可用内存的系统,增加此值(例如,2048m
)。
运行旧版本的NetBeans或Java可能会导致性能不佳。遵循以下建议以克服这些问题:
项目设置可以显著影响性能,具体取决于项目的大小和复杂性:
操作系统设置也能影响NetBeans的性能。您可以:
内存泄漏可能导致性能随时间下降。以下是一些检测和修复内存泄漏的步骤:
使用NetBeans Profiler监控内存使用情况。通过导航到Profiles > Attach Profiler > Advanced Settings访问分析器。按照提示将分析器附加到您的应用程序。
如果一切都失败了,请考虑联系NetBeans社区寻求帮助。方法如下:
和任何复杂软件一样,NetBeans可能会有性能问题,给开发过程带来挑战。通过遵循上述策略,从优化NetBeans配置和设置到系统和项目特定的调整,您可以显著减少这些问题并保持高效的工作流程。了解您可以使用的工具和选项将有助于创建无缝体验,让您能够有效地专注于开发任务。
如果你发现文章内容有误, 您可以